GSM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2015 in Review
137 of the 3,824 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in FerroAtlántica (GSM) for Q4 2015, worth a combined $663M — down 12% from $757M a quarter earlier.
Buyers outnumbered sellers: 33 funds opened new GSM positions and 32 closed out — a net gain of 1 holder — while 54 added to existing stakes and 38 trimmed.
The largest buyer was Adage Capital Partners, adding an estimated $31.7M. The largest seller was BlackRock Fund Advisors, cutting an estimated $25.9M.
